The Professional Certificate in Music & Sound Effects Licensing offers exciting and diverse career opportunities in the UK's creative industry. Here are some of the key roles in this field and their respective job market trends, represented in a visually appealing 3D Pie chart. 1. **Music Licensing Specialist (60%)** Music Licensing Specialists are responsible for obtaining legal permissions and negotiating terms for using copyrighted music in various media. This role has seen steady growth due to the increasing demand for original music in advertising, film, TV, and video games. 2. **Sound Designer (25%)** Sound Designers create and implement sound effects, ambient noise, and other audio elements in various media. As technology advances and immersive experiences become more popular, the demand for skilled Sound Designers continues to rise. 3. **Music Supervisor (10%)** Music Supervisors work closely with directors, producers, and other creative professionals to select and license music for film, TV, and other visual media. This role requires a deep understanding of music copyright laws, negotiation skills, and an extensive music library. 4. **Audio Post-production Engineer (5%)** Audio Post-production Engineers are responsible for mixing, editing, and mastering audio recordings for film, TV, and other visual media. They ensure that the audio elements align with the project's creative vision and technical requirements.
